Key Ingredients for the Perfect Peach Milkshake
Crafting the perfect, irresistibly delicious peach milkshake begins with the thoughtful selection of high-quality ingredients. Each component plays an absolutely vital role in achieving that incredible depth of flavor, luscious texture, and overall delightful experience:
- Fresh, Ripe Peaches: These are the undeniable cornerstone of this shake! For the most vibrant and authentic peach flavor, always opt for peaches that are deeply fragrant, yield ever-so-slightly to gentle pressure when squeezed, and display a beautiful, vibrant color. Ripe peaches naturally provide the most intense sweetness and robust peach flavor, essential for both the filling and the final shake. If fresh peaches are genuinely unavailable, high-quality frozen peaches (fully thawed) or even good canned peaches can be utilized, though using fresh will undeniably yield the superior result.
- Granulated & Brown Sugar: These two sweeteners are synergistically used in the homemade peach pie filling. Granulated sugar provides a clean, straightforward sweetness that highlights the fruit, while brown sugar adds a deeper, more complex, and molasses-like flavor. This subtle richness beautifully complements the peaches, imparting that classic “pie filling” characteristic. Always adjust the quantity to your peaches’ inherent natural sweetness and your personal preference.
- Fresh Lemon Juice: This is a culinary secret weapon for brightening and enhancing flavors! A small but significant amount of fresh lemon juice added to the filling masterfully balances the sweetness of the peaches, preventing the filling from becoming overly cloying or heavy. Furthermore, it helps to preserve the peaches’ beautiful, vibrant color during cooking, ensuring an appealing presentation.
- Ground Cinnamon & Nutmeg: These warm, inviting spices are the quintessential companions to peaches. Cinnamon lends a wonderfully comforting, aromatic quality that instantly evokes the feeling of freshly baked goods, while nutmeg contributes a subtle, earthy, and nutty depth. Together, they transform simple peaches into a complex, incredibly inviting, and warmly spiced flavor profile that is utterly irresistible.
- Cornstarch: This is an absolutely essential ingredient for thickening the homemade peach pie filling to a beautifully spoonable, glossy, and sauce-like consistency. When carefully mixed with cold water to form a smooth slurry before being added to the hot peaches, it effectively prevents lumps and ensures a perfectly smooth, luscious finish for your peach sauce.
- Milk: The fundamental liquid base for our wonderfully creamy shake. I typically recommend using 2% milk for an excellent balance of richness and lightness, but opting for whole milk will undoubtedly result in an even richer, noticeably thicker, and more indulgent milkshake. How to Craft Your Perfect Peach Milkshake: A Detailed Step-by-Step Guide
Mastering this Peach Milkshake Recipe is genuinely simpler than you might imagine. Follow these detailed, easy-to-understand steps to create a truly sensational and unforgettable summer treat:
Step 1: Prepare the Luscious Homemade Peach Pie Filling. This crucial homemade component is precisely what truly elevates our milkshake far above the ordinary. Begin by thoroughly washing your fresh peaches and then dicing them into evenly sized pieces. While leaving the skins on is an option for a rustic texture, peeling them beforehand will undeniably result in a smoother, more refined, and velvety filling. In a medium-sized saucepan, combine your diced peaches with granulated sugar, brown sugar, a brightening splash of fresh lemon juice, vanilla extract, ground cinnamon, and ground nutmeg. Cook this delightful mixture over medium heat, stirring occasionally to prevent sticking, for approximately 6 to 8 minutes. During this time, the peaches will beautifully soften, and their natural, sweet juices will gracefully release, creating a wonderfully bubbly and fragrant sauce.
In a small, separate bowl, whisk together the cornstarch and cold water until a perfectly smooth slurry forms – this will be your effective thickening agent. Pour this cornstarch slurry into the gently simmering peach mixture in the saucepan and continue to cook for just 1 additional minute, stirring constantly to ensure even distribution, until the filling visibly thickens to a glossy, spoonable consistency that truly resembles a rich, homemade pie filling. Immediately remove the saucepan from the heat and carefully transfer the hot filling to a clean medium bowl. For optimal results in your milkshake, this filling absolutely needs to be completely cool before blending. Place the bowl in the refrigerator for at least one hour, or to significantly expedite the cooling process, place it in the freezer for a quick 10 to 15 minutes, stirring once or twice during this time to ensure thorough and even chilling.

Step 2: Thoughtfully Assemble All Ingredients in Your Blender. Once your exquisite peach pie filling is thoroughly chilled, it’s finally time to assemble and blend your masterpiece! For the most efficient and effective blending, especially when dealing with thicker, creamier ingredients, it is always a best practice to add liquids to your blender first. Begin by pouring the specified amount of cold milk into your blender carafe. Next, carefully spoon in approximately two-thirds of your completely cooled homemade peach pie filling (make sure to reserve the remaining one-third for a spectacular garnish – you will undoubtedly thank yourself later for this!). Then, add generous scoops of very cold, firm vanilla bean ice cream, followed by the additional vanilla bean paste (or extract if using), and finish with the warming touches of cinnamon and a delicate pinch of nutmeg. Expert Tips for the Best Peach Milkshake Every Time
Elevate your homemade milkshake game to professional levels with these tried-and-true expert tips for an absolutely unforgettable peach experience:
- Selecting Perfectly Ripe Peaches: The quality and ripeness of your peaches directly and significantly impact the overall flavor profile of your milkshake. Always look for peaches that emit a sweet, inviting, and distinctly floral aroma. They should also yield slightly to gentle pressure when you give them a light squeeze. Don’t be deterred by a few minor bruises; these are perfectly acceptable since the peaches will be cooked down into a filling. However, rigorously avoid peaches that are rock-hard or completely mushy. Trust your sense of smell – a wonderfully fragrant peach is often the best indicator of perfect ripeness and maximum flavor.
- Crucially Chill Your Peach Filling Completely: This particular step is absolutely non-negotiable for achieving a wonderfully thick, indulgent milkshake. Blending peach filling that is even slightly warm or lukewarm will instantaneously melt your ice cream, inevitably resulting in a thin, watery, and disappointing shake. Always allow the homemade peach filling to cool down completely in the refrigerator. For those moments when you’re short on time, expedite the chilling process by placing it in the freezer for a quick 10 to 15 minutes, making sure to stir it once or twice to ensure uniform cooling.
- Optimize Your Blending Technique for Ideal Consistency: When blending, always initiate your blender on a low speed. This gentle start effectively breaks down the ice cream and peach filling without overworking the mixture. Gradually increase the speed as the ingredients begin to combine. If you notice your milkshake appears too thick for the blades to move freely, add milk judiciously, one tablespoon at a time, until the mixture flows smoothly. Conversely, if your milkshake turns out too thin for your liking, simply add another generous scoop of ice cream and blend again briefly. Crucially, avoid over-blending, which can inadvertently warm the mixture and diminish its desired thickness and creaminess.

Homemade Peach Milkshakes with Peach Pie Filling
By Stephanie Simmons
These homemade Peach Milkshakes are bursting with the authentic, sun-kissed flavor of summer! A quick, luscious peach pie filling, simmered with warm spices like cinnamon and nutmeg, is perfectly blended into rich, creamy vanilla bean ice cream along with fresh milk and a touch of extra vanilla. The result is the ultimate refreshing treat, offering a velvety smooth, deeply flavorful, and incredibly satisfying peach shake that will undoubtedly be the most delicious you’ll ever taste!
Cook: 8 mins
Yields: 3 large shakes, or 6 smaller servings
Print Recipe
Ingredients
For the Homemade Peach Pie Filling
- 4 large fresh peaches, diced (approx. 4 cups or 1.5 lbs)
- 1/4 cup granulated sugar
- 2 to 3 tbsp brown sugar (add extra to taste, based on peach sweetness)
- 3/4 tsp vanilla extract
- 1 tsp fresh lemon juice
- 3/4 tsp ground cinnamon
- 1/4 tsp ground nutmeg
- 1.5 tsp cornstarch
- 1.5 tsp cold water
For the Creamy Peach Milkshakes
- 3/4 cup milk (2% or whole milk recommended for best creaminess)
- Two-thirds of the prepared peach pie filling (from above)
- 3 cups premium vanilla bean ice cream (very cold)
- 1 tsp vanilla bean paste (or vanilla extract for a similar effect)
- 1/2 tsp ground cinnamon, plus more for garnish
- Pinch of ground nutmeg
For Serving (Optional Garnishes)
- Reserved extra peach pie filling
- Fresh whipped cream
- Cinnamon sticks
- Fresh peach slices or chunks
Instructions
-
1. Make the Peach Pie Filling: In a medium saucepan, combine your diced peaches, granulated sugar, brown sugar, fresh lemon juice, 3/4 tsp vanilla extract, 3/4 tsp cinnamon, and 1/4 tsp nutmeg. Cook this mixture over medium heat for about 6-8 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the peaches soften and their juices begin to bubble. In a small separate bowl, whisk together the 1.5 tsp cornstarch and 1.5 tsp cold water until smooth to create a slurry. Stir this cornstarch slurry into the simmering peach mixture in the saucepan and continue to cook for 1 additional minute, stirring constantly, until the filling visibly thickens to a glossy, spoonable consistency. Immediately remove from heat and transfer the filling to a medium bowl. It is crucial to cool this filling completely in the refrigerator (this typically takes about 1 hour) or expedite the process in the freezer (10-15 minutes, stirring once or twice) before using it in the milkshakes.
-
2. Make the Milkshakes: Add the milk to your blender first. Then, add approximately two-thirds of the completely cooled peach pie filling, followed by the vanilla bean ice cream, 1 tsp vanilla bean paste (or vanilla extract), 1/2 tsp cinnamon, and a pinch of nutmeg.
-
3. Blend to Creamy Perfection: Secure the lid on your blender and blend on a low speed, gradually increasing to medium or high, until all the ingredients are thoroughly combined into a perfectly smooth, thick, and creamy milkshake. Blend just until desired consistency is reached; avoid over-blending as this can cause the ice cream to melt and the shake to thin out. If the milkshake is too thick, add a tablespoon of milk at a time; if too thin, add another scoop of ice cream.
-
4. Serve with Flair and Store: Pour the freshly blended milkshakes into chilled serving glasses. For an extra special touch, you can spoon some of the reserved peach pie filling around the inside of each glass before pouring in the milkshake for a beautiful marbled effect. Top generously with fresh whipped cream, a spoonful of the remaining peach pie filling, a light dusting of cinnamon, and a decorative cinnamon stick. Serve immediately for the best taste and texture. Any leftover milkshake mixture can be frozen in an airtight container and enjoyed later as a delightful peach ice cream.
